commit 4e9a5ae8df5b3365183150f6df49e49dece80d8c upstream

Since insn.prefixes.nbytes can be bigger than the size of
insn.prefixes.bytes[] when a prefix is repeated, the proper check must
be

  insn.prefixes.bytes[i] != 0 and i < 4

instead of using insn.prefixes.nbytes.

Introduce a for_each_insn_prefix() macro for this purpose. Debugged by
Kees Cook <[email protected]>.

 [ bp: Massage commit message, sync with the respective header in tools/
   and drop "we". ]

Fixes: 2b1444983508 ("uprobes, mm, x86: Add the ability to install and remove 
uprobes breakpoints")

--- a/arch/x86/include/asm/insn.h
+++ b/arch/x86/include/asm/insn.h
@@ -208,6 +208,21 @@ static inline int insn_offset_immediate(
        return insn_offset_displacement(insn) + insn->displacement.nbytes;
 }
 
+/**
+ * for_each_insn_prefix() -- Iterate prefixes in the instruction
+ * @insn: Pointer to struct insn.
+ * @idx:  Index storage.
+ * @prefix: Prefix byte.
+ *
+ * Iterate prefix bytes of given @insn. Each prefix byte is stored in @prefix
+ * and the index is stored in @idx (note that this @idx is just for a cursor,
+ * do not change it.)
+ * Since prefixes.nbytes can be bigger than 4 if some prefixes
+ * are repeated, it cannot be used for looping over the prefixes.
+ */
+#define for_each_insn_prefix(insn, idx, prefix)        \
+       for (idx = 0; idx < ARRAY_SIZE(insn->prefixes.bytes) && (prefix = 
insn->prefixes.bytes[idx]) != 0; idx++)
+
 #define POP_SS_OPCODE 0x1f
 #define MOV_SREG_OPCODE 0x8e
 
--- a/arch/x86/kernel/uprobes.c
+++ b/arch/x86/kernel/uprobes.c
@@ -268,10 +268,11 @@ static volatile u32 good_2byte_insns[256
 
 static bool is_prefix_bad(struct insn *insn)
 {
+       insn_byte_t p;
        int i;
 
-       for (i = 0; i < insn->prefixes.nbytes; i++) {
-               switch (insn->prefixes.bytes[i]) {
+       for_each_insn_prefix(insn, i, p) {
+               switch (p) {
                case 0x26:      /* INAT_PFX_ES   */
                case 0x2E:      /* INAT_PFX_CS   */
                case 0x36:      /* INAT_PFX_DS   */
@@ -711,6 +712,7 @@ static const struct uprobe_xol_ops branc
 static int branch_setup_xol_ops(struct arch_uprobe *auprobe, struct insn *insn)
 {
        u8 opc1 = OPCODE1(insn);
+       insn_byte_t p;
        int i;
 
        switch (opc1) {
@@ -741,8 +743,8 @@ static int branch_setup_xol_ops(struct a
         * Intel and AMD behavior differ in 64-bit mode: Intel ignores 66 
prefix.
         * No one uses these insns, reject any branch insns with such prefix.
         */
-       for (i = 0; i < insn->prefixes.nbytes; i++) {
-               if (insn->prefixes.bytes[i] == 0x66)
+       for_each_insn_prefix(insn, i, p) {
+               if (p == 0x66)
                        return -ENOTSUPP;
        }
